Wed 5-21-03
Test audio with Calle in Sweden Kingsley and
Robert at Stanford. All three participants were in the Atmosphere world as well as the Talker environment. We were able to control the heart rate using the buttons in the Controls. The message was received by each of the participants so that the correct values were displayed on the screen. more...
Thurs 5-22-03
Calle, Li in Sweden, Leroy, Pat, Sakti, Robert
at Stanford
We had four avatars in the world, plus all four in Talker. Li was able
to move around and transmit and receive audio. Li has a 3 Mbps connection,
so the problems with Calle could be due to the network. The audio quality
with Calle was still poor, and again he could interact with the world. more...
